Historical Events for 21st July 2021

1669 – John Locke’s Constitution of English colony Carolina is approved
1919 – Anthony Fokker’s establishes airplane factory at Hamburg and Amsterdam
1930 – US Veterans Administration forms
1944 – Field Marshal Günther von Kluge warns Hitler of impending collapse of front in Normandy
1954 – Geneva Accords for Indochina signed, dividing French colonial territories into the countries of the Democratic Republic of Vietnam (North Vietnam), the State of Vietnam (South Vietnam), Cambodia, and Laos
1956 – US performs atmospheric nuclear Test at Enwetak
1970 – Clay Kirby has a no-hitter going for 8 inn, but is lifted for a pinch hitter, Reliever Jack Baldschun gives up 3 hits and Padres lose, 3-0
1980 – Jean-Claude Droyer climbs Eiffel Tower in 2 hrs 18 mins
1985 – Amina Fakir (Detroit), 23, crowned 18th Miss Black America
1989 – Mike Tyson KOs Carl Williams in 1:33 for heavyweight boxing title
